How can I learn Korean in BTS?

BTS launched “Learn Korean with BTS” on its global fan community app, Weverse, on March 24, 2020. The short Korean courses feature episodes that were released every Monday during the pandemic for the group's passionate fans.

Which type of Korean Do BTS speak?

Busan satoori is probably the most well known for its agressive sound and phrases. It is often used in a lot of Korean media. Even when BTS speaks in a Seoul accent sometimes the satoori is still prominent in their speach, and sometimes they intentionally emphasize their natural satoori.

What are the basic Korean words?

Here is a list of some of the common basic Korean words:
  • Hello – 안녕하세요 (annyeonghaseyo)
  • Please – 주세요 (juseyo)
  • Sorry – 죄송합니다 (joesonghamnida)
  • Thank you – 고맙습니다 (gomapseumnida)
  • Yes – 네 (ne)
  • No – 아니요 (aniyo)
  • Maybe – 아마도 (amado)
  • Help – 도와 주세요 (dowa juseyo)

How long do u need to learn Korean?

How long does it take to become fluent in Korean? It will take about 1200 hours to reach a high intermediate level. You'll need additional practice, so you may want to double that number to 2400 hours to get towards fluency. That would be about 23 hours of study per week for 2 years.

What is Z Korean?

Because the /z/ sound is basically a voiced /s/ sound, which is simply not represented in the Korean alphabet. At least, not anymore. So they must use the character that sounds closest, which is ㅈ. The English word "pizza" is pronounced like "pitsa," which if directly transliterated in Hangul would look like 핏.... 사.
